City of Vancouver’s Rain City Strategy

“Vancouver City council has adopted a 2050 target that would see rainfall filtered through green infrastructure across 40 per cent of Vancouver’s land area. The idea is to simulate a natural water cycle wiped out from decades of city building,” explains Stefan Labbé. He then quotes Melina Scholefield, the City of Vancouver’s manager of green infrastructure implementation, as follows:

“In the old days, it was ‘scoop the water up and send it down these pipes.’ Now, with climate change, we have to restore these old systems. That’s the whole paradigm shift.” 

“Scholefield said Vancouver has had its own growing pains. Though it has an over 20-year history installing green infrastructure, until 2018, it was rarely done systematically and did not use geotechnical studies to understand how fast water could penetrate the ground underfoot,” Stefan Labbé notes.

Reconnect People, Land, Fish and Water

“Public support is integral for the implementation of sustainable development solutions,” continues Andrea McDonald. “Local stewards across the LFW have been essential in providing that bottom-up pressure necessary to push governments towards more sustainable development solutions. However, what happens when that bottom-up pressure from these dedicated parties does not exist? What if the community does not support or fully understand the cause?”

“My research highlights the barriers local governments face when communities are unfamiliar with the problem, and ultimately do not fully support the solution. Many cities in the LFW have eliminated or severely altered the original salmon-bearing stream networks across the watershed. Not having the visual connection and reminder of what impacts urbanization has on wild salmon, and local watersheds more broadly, has limited the public support for solutions.”

“With limited staff capacity and tight government budgets, it is important that the public is understanding and supportive of larger-scale initiatives, especially ones that have not historically been the norm. Providing opportunities for the public to be more engaged and educated on the subject can offer that bottom-up pressure necessary for more rapid-paced change in local governments.”

Flashback to 2006 and the Metro Vancouver Showcasing Green Infrastructure Innovation Series

“Launched in May 2006 in Metro Vancouver, the Celebrating Green Infrastructure Program: Showcasing Innovation Series was a provincial pilot. The program goal was to build regional capacity through the sharing of approaches and lessons learned as an outcome of ‘designing with nature’,” stated Kim Stephens, Executive Director, Partnership for Water Sustainability.

“The program was an outcome of the May 2005 Consultation Workshop organized by the BC Green Infrastructure Partnership in collaboration with the Regional Engineers Advisory Committee (REAC). The cities of Vancouver and Surrey, along with the District of North Vancouver, each hosted a day in the series.”

Greening Local Roadways

The City of Vancouver and UBC co-hosted the third in the Celebrating Green Infrastructure pilot program. The unifying theme for their event was “Greening Local Roadways – Integration of Rainwater Management & Transportation Design”.

“Vancouver’s Green Streets Program for streetscape enhancement began in 1994 as a pilot project in Vancouver’s Mount Pleasant neighbourhood. The success of the project inspired other neighbourhoods to get involved and liven up their streets,” stated David Desrochers in 2006.

David Desrochers is the visionary engineer who provided the driving force for the City of Vancouver’s initiatives in implementing both Country Lanes and Crown Street. “Yes, I am one who pushes the envelope in advocating new ways of building streets and lanes”, admitted Desrochers, “But I could not have made either Crown Street or Country Lanes happen without the strong support and commitment of Don Brynildsen, the City’s Assistant City Engineer.”

We Too Can Do This!

“It was an interesting to observe the reactions by other municipal engineers when David Desrochers took them on the walkabout and explained the philosophy behind the greening of previously paved lanes,” stated Kim Stephens.

“The typical reaction was ‘what’s the big deal. We can do this’ And that was the point. Green infrastructure is not rocket science; it is a commonsense application of basic principles. By leading the way with demonstration applications. David Desrochers had a significant influence on how municipal engineers of the time perceived green infrastructure. He inspired many,”
